Election 2025: Theard-Griggs, Agbarah win endorsement from D161 teachers union

The Flossmoor Education Association, the teachers union for Flossmoor schools, has given its support to Carolyn Theard-Griggs and Elizabeth Agbarah as candidates in the District 161 school board election. Both currently serve on the board.

Candidates were selected after answering surveys from the association. Those surveys were then evaluated by the FEA executive board whose members reached a final decision on which candidates to support.

There are four seats open on the District 161 board in the April 1 election. Candidates are Agbarah and Griggs, Jason Bizjak, Tre Childress, Crystal Cleggett, Ashly Giddens and Cameron Nelson.

Theard-Griggs has been serving on the school board since 2017. Today she is the board’s president. A former elementary school teacher she now works in higher education. Theard-Griggs says she believes strongly in transparent and effective communication between all stakeholders.

Agbarah works in the nonprofit sector. She was appointed to the board in August 2023 to fill a vacancy. Agbarah says she is committed to enhancing educational opportunities, strengthening academic programs and ensuring fiscal responsibility.
